The Orvane Labs bike cage and the east and west parking gates operate on separate access schedules, and facilities desk staff should note that visitor vehicles may only use the west gate between 07:00 and 19:00. Cyclists requesting cage access must show a valid day pass, and their details should be entered in the access ledger before the cage is opened. Gates must never be propped open, even briefly, during deliveries. When a manual override is required at either gate, use the code below.

staff pass of fadup-fawig = bdg-FUNKS-4

### Step 4: Update your canary gating rules

Okay, this is the step people skip and then regret at 3 a.m. The new Rolloway gating engine evaluates error rate, p99 latency, and saturation together — a breach on any single metric no longer auto-rolls back unless it persists for two consecutive windows. That means fewer false-alarm reverts, but you need to actually watch the canary dashboard during the bake period. Promotion is blocked until all gates report green. The default gate thresholds shipping with this release are below.

deployment values, taweg-bajop:
[fenvan]
port = 5672
team = holmir
host = fenvan.orvexio.example
region = lower-1
access_code = ac_b98bc6
timeout_ms = 1500

Handover: DiffLens large-file viewer (from Mara to Osric). The chunked renderer streams files above 50 MB through the sidecar, never holding both revisions in memory. Access checks run before hydration, and temp artifacts are shredded on session close. Please audit the sanitizer path in particular. The current service configuration, exactly as deployed to the review environment, follows below.

settings of tagef-bawif:
DRUIX_HOST=druix.zemvarlabs.internal
DRUIX_PORT=8000

## Configuration

The Velvetine seat-map renderer for the Orpheum Lane theatre reads its settings from `.env` at startup. Most values (stage orientation, tier colors, aisle padding) are safe defaults, but the renderer refuses to boot without a valid signing credential for hold-token generation. After the standard variables, add the following line exactly as issued by the platform team.

vault entry, kafog-yahop: COURIER_KEY8=0faa53ae